It's gameday as the Cats get set for what's shaping up to be one of their biggest regular-season games.

Texas A&M may be on a bit of a slump, but they're still a very dangerous team that will give the Cats all they can handle and then some. Winning at Texas A&M would be huge for a variety of reasons, one of which being that UK would maintain their hold on the SEC, not to mention a great resume-booster.

This isn't a game UK has to win by any means, especially given how much any ranked team has struggled on the road this season. Still, this feels like a game the Cats should win if they just bring their A game and take care of business.

Let's hope that ends up being the case.
